软件项目团队管理是什么
-
软件项目团队管理是指在软件项目中,负责对团队成员进行组织、协调和管理的活动。它涉及到对项目人员的配置、任务分派、进度监控、沟通协作以及决策和风险管理等方面的工作。
软件项目团队管理的主要目标是确保项目能够按照计划和预期完成,同时要保证团队成员的积极性和合作性。为了实现这些目标,软件项目团队管理需要从以下几个方面展开工作:
1.团队建设:团队建设是软件项目团队管理的基础,通过建设一个强大的团队,可以提高团队成员的合作能力,增强团队的凝聚力和战斗力。团队建设包括招募和选拔有才华的人员、组织团队培训和开展团队建设活动等。
2.任务分派与进度监控:在软件项目中,需要根据项目计划将任务分配给团队成员,并监控任务的进度和质量。任务分派和进度监控是确保项目能够按时完成的重要环节,它需要领导者具备合理分配资源、制定清晰目标、建立有效沟通渠道和及时解决问题的能力。
3.沟通协作:软件项目团队管理需要通过有效的沟通和协作来推动项目的进展。领导者应该与团队成员保持良好的沟通,明确任务目标,解决问题和冲突。同时,也需要通过团队协作来促进成员之间的合作和配合。
4.决策和风险管理:在软件项目中,领导者需要做出各种决策,例如制定项目计划、调整资源分配等。同时,还需要对项目风险进行有效的管理,及时识别和解决可能影响项目进展的风险因素。
总结起来,软件项目团队管理是一项综合性的工作,涉及到团队建设、任务分派与进度监控、沟通协作和决策与风险管理等方面。通过有效的团队管理,可以提高项目的成功率和效率,保证软件项目能够按时完成。
2年前 -
软件项目团队管理是指对软件开发项目团队的组织、协调和监督,以确保项目按时、按质、按预算完成的过程。软件项目团队管理包括管理团队成员、分配资源、制定项目计划、定义工作任务、监控进度、解决问题和沟通等。成功的软件项目团队管理可以确保项目顺利进行并达到预期目标。
以下是软件项目团队管理的重要方面:
1. 团队建设:团队建设是软件项目团队管理的首要任务。团队成员之间的合作和协作是项目成功的关键因素。团队建设包括招聘和培训成员,建立正确的沟通渠道和团队文化,以及建立相互信任和支持的关系。
2. 项目计划和目标设定:项目计划是软件项目团队管理的核心。团队经理需要根据项目的范围、需求和时间表,制定详细的项目计划。计划应包括工作分配、任务安排、里程碑和时间表等。同时,团队经理还需要设定清晰的项目目标和预期结果,以便团队成员明确工作方向。
3. 任务分配和监控:团队经理需要根据项目计划将任务分配给各个团队成员,确保每个人都清楚自己的工作职责和目标。此外,团队经理还需要监控团队成员的工作进展,及时发现并解决潜在问题,确保项目按时完成。
4. 风险管理:软件项目团队管理需要有效识别和管理项目风险。团队经理应针对各种风险因素进行评估和规划,制定应对策略,并监控风险的发展和变化,保证项目不受影响。团队成员也应参与风险管理,提供问题解决方案和意见。
5. 沟通和协调:软件项目团队管理需要建立良好的沟通和协调机制。团队经理应与团队成员保持定期沟通,了解工作进展和团队需求,并提供必要的支持和指导。此外,团队经理还需要与项目相关方进行沟通,确保他们了解项目进展和需要的支持。团队成员之间的协调和合作也是团队管理的关键,可以通过会议、工作流程和协作工具来实现。
2年前 -
软件项目团队管理是指一系列管理方法、技术和工具的应用,以确保软件项目按时、按质、按成本完成的过程。它涉及到项目计划制定、任务分配、进度控制、沟通协调、风险管理等多个方面,是保证软件项目成功的关键环节之一。
软件项目团队管理的目标是通过合理的资源分配和项目管理,最大限度地提高团队的效率和工作质量,同时降低项目风险和成本,并确保项目按时交付。
下面将从方法、操作流程等方面介绍软件项目团队管理的具体内容。
一、方法和技术
1. 项目规划:在软件项目开始之前,项目经理需要制定详细的项目规划,确定项目的范围、目标、任务和资源需求,并制定项目计划和进度安排。
2. 团队组建:根据项目需求和团队成员的技能和经验,项目经理需要组建一个高效的团队。团队成员的角色和职责需要明确,以便保证团队合作顺利进行。
3. 任务分解:将项目中的任务分解为小的可管理的单元,指派给团队成员,并制定详细的任务计划。这样可以更好地控制项目进度和资源分配。
4. 进度控制:通过制定项目进度表、跟踪任务进展、定期开展团队会议等方式,实时监控项目进度,并及时调整资源和任务分配,以保证项目按时完成。
5. 沟通协调:项目经理需要与团队成员、客户和其他相关方进行积极的沟通,及时解决问题和调整项目计划。有效的沟通可以提高团队的工作效率和协作能力。
6. 风险管理:项目经理需要提前识别和评估项目风险,并制定相应的应对策略。定期进行风险评估和风险控制可以降低项目的不确定性和失败风险。
7. 质量管理:项目团队需要制定详细的质量标准和测试计划,确保软件产品满足客户需求,并及时纠正和改进质量问题。
8. 绩效评估:对团队成员的工作进行评估和反馈,及时发现问题并采取措施,提高团队成员的个人能力和团队合作水平。
二、操作流程
1. 确定项目目标和需求:明确项目目标和需求,制定项目计划和进度安排。
2. 组建团队:根据项目需求和技能要求,组建一个高效的团队,并确定团队成员的角色和职责。
3. 制定任务分配和计划:将项目任务分解为小的可管理的单元,指派给团队成员,并制定详细的任务计划。
4. 开展项目工作:团队成员根据任务计划,按时完成各自的工作,并及时进行交付和沟通。
5. 进度控制和调整:项目经理跟踪项目进度,及时调整资源和任务分配,确保项目按时完成。
6. 沟通和协调:积极与团队成员、客户和其他相关方沟通,及时解决问题和调整项目计划。
7. 风险管理和控制:识别并评估项目风险,并制定相应的应对策略,定期进行风险评估和控制。
8. 质量管理和改进:制定质量标准和测试计划,确保软件产品质量,及时纠正和改进质量问题。
9. 绩效评估和反馈:对团队成员的工作进行评估和反馈,及时发现问题并采取措施,提高团队绩效。
以上是软件项目团队管理的方法和操作流程,通过合理的项目规划、任务分配、进度控制、沟通协调、风险管理、质量管理和绩效评估等手段,可以提高团队的工作效率和工作质量,确保项目按时、按质、按成本完成。
2年前